Common Maintenance Tasks
Maintaining commercial HVAC systems involves a variety of tasks that are essential for ensuring optimal performance and longevity. Some of the most common maintenance tasks include:
- Inspecting and replacing air filters: Dirty filters can restrict airflow and reduce efficiency. Regularly changing filters ensures optimal airflow and air quality.
- Cleaning and lubricating moving parts: Keeping components clean and well-lubricated reduces wear and tear, extending the equipment’s lifespan.
- Checking and recalibrating thermostats: Accurate thermostats are crucial for maintaining consistent temperatures and energy efficiency.
- Ensuring proper refrigerant levels: Low refrigerant levels can impair the system’s cooling capacity, leading to increased energy consumption.
- Inspecting electrical connections: Loose or faulty electrical connections can pose safety hazards and impact the system’s performance.
By addressing these tasks regularly, businesses can ensure their HVAC systems operate at peak efficiency and minimize the risk of unexpected breakdowns.
Cost Savings Through Preventative Maintenance
Preventative maintenance can save significant costs by avoiding major repairs and reducing energy consumption. According to the U.S. Department of Energy, regular HVAC maintenance can reduce energy use by 5% to 40%. These savings can translate to thousands of dollars annually for large commercial establishments, making maintenance a sound investment. By proactively addressing potential issues, businesses can avoid the high costs of emergency repairs and system replacements. Moreover, energy-efficient systems contribute to lower utility bills, further enhancing the financial benefits of regular maintenance.
Impact on Indoor Air Quality
Poor indoor air quality can have severe implications for employee health and productivity. Regular maintenance helps ensure filters and ducts are clean, reducing the spread of allergens, bacteria, and mold. This improvement in air quality is essential for maintaining a healthy indoor environment. Clean air contributes to a more pleasant and productive workspace, benefiting the business’s bottom line. Employees will likely experience fewer health issues, reducing absenteeism and overall productivity. Additionally, a well-maintained HVAC system can help regulate humidity levels, enhancing comfort and air quality.
